<description>&lt;p&gt;A summary of the specifications of Ruger's Old Army .45 revolver are as follows.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;    * Type: muzzleloading, cap and ball, six-shot revolver&lt;br /&gt;
    * Caliber: .45 BP&lt;br /&gt;
    * Proper ball or conical bullet diameter: .457&quot;&lt;br /&gt;
    * Overall length: 13 1/2&quot; (with 7.5&quot; barrel)&lt;br /&gt;
    * Weight: 2 7/8 pounds
